What owners report
Service Brakes is the most-reported problem area on the 2024 Acura RDX, cited in 2 of 11 filed complaints (18%).
Visibility/Wiper is next (2 complaints, 18%), followed by Air Bags (1), Electrical System (1), Engine (1).
Across all complaints, 1 report a crash, 1 report a fire, 2 report injuries.
The most safety-critical cluster is Service Brakes: 1 crash, 2 injury report(s).

“This issue involves the decorative aluminum trim on the steering wheel. The aluminum trim is highly reflective and installed at an angle on the steering wheel spokes. In bright sunlight and at certain angles of the sun there is a very strong light reflection into the drivers eyes. This has caused temporary blindness until the position of the car changes or you put a hand over that part of the trim. The lower spoke (at about the 6 o'clock position) is the worst. Since it is a design flaw, I have not reported it to the dealer.”

“The contact owns a 2024 Acura RDX. The contact stated that while the child was seated in the rear driver's seat, the seatbelt buckle locking mechanism had malfunctioned. The contact was unable to unlatch the seat belt buckle and eventually scissors were used to cut the the seat belt strap in order to free the child. The vehicle was taken to the local dealer who was unable to determine the cause of the failure. The manufacturer was notified of the failure but no assistance was offered. The failure mileage was 5,000.”

How we read this (methodology)
How to read this: raw complaint totals are not a clean reliability score — a model year with more cars sold, or simply more years on the road, accumulates more complaints regardless of how good it is. So this page leans on two signals that are not distorted by sales volume: the share of complaints falling on each vehicle system (the breakdown above) and NHTSA's own crash / fire / injury / death flags. When we compare model years of the same model, we normalise by years on the road (complaints ÷ vehicle age) rather than comparing raw totals. Age-normalised, the 2024 Acura RDX draws about 3.7 complaints per year on the road, ranking 11 of 15 among the Acura RDX model years we have ingested (1 = most complaints per year on road).
